The key difference between the fender washer vs flat washer is that for the same inner diameter the fender washer has a larger outer diameter than the flat washer, and thus the fender washer has more bearing surface than the flat washer.

Fender washer:
The fender washer is a flat washer with an outer diameter comparatively larger than the inner diameter. For a fender washer, the outer diameter is generally more than 3 times of the inner diameter.
The fender washers have a wider bearing surface that helps to spread the load over the larger surface of the object. Thus it helps to lower the pressure over the object’s surface.
Flat washer:
Flat washers are what everyone thinks about the washer. These are the most used plain circular washers with an appropriate-sized hole at the center.
The basic purpose of using a flat washer is to spread the load over the surface area of the object. Thus it reduces the pressure on the fastened object.
Fender washer vs Flat washer:
Sr. No. | Fender washer | Flat washer |
---|---|---|
1 | The fender washer is a circular washer with an outer diameter larger in comparison with the inner diameter | The flat washer is a plain circular disc made from a thin sheet of material with a hole at the center. |
2 | In this washer, the outer diameter is more than 3 times of the inner diameter. | In this washer, the outer diameter is generally less than 3 times of inner diameter. |
3 | It has a wider bearing surface. | It has a comparatively less bearing surface. |
4 | The fender washers are suitable for covering the oversize hole. | These are not suitable for oversize holes. |
5 | The wider surface of the washer helps to distribute the load due to the tightening of fasteners over the surface of the object. | The fastening load is distributed within less surface area. |
6 | The name of the fender washer arises due to its use for the automobile fender. | The flat washer is named on the basis of its appearance as circular and flat. |
7 | It creates less pressure on the object surface due to the fastening load. | It creates comparatively more pressure on the surface of the object due to the fastening load. |
8 | It is suitable for the fitting of thin-walled components. | It is not suitable for the fitting of thin-walled components. |
9 | The fender washers are used in sheet metal applications, hanging signboards, plumbing, etc. | The flat washers have huge applications in automobiles plumbing, industrial equipment, and much more. |
